The Carroll Police Department is currently searching for a male who is on the loose after allegedly stabbing a female on North Main Street. With the suspect on the loose and near areas near the Carroll Community Schools the school district has been locked down for the safety of the students and employees.

Parents were notified in a recorded message from Superintendent Rob Cordes which said all buildings are locked down after the stabbing that was two blocks from Adams Elementary School. He also said all students, teachers and administrators are safe.

Carroll Police Chief Jeff Cayler says his department, the Carroll County Sheriff’s Department and a member of the State Fire Marshal’s Office are out looking for the man. “We would like to encourage the public to kind of keep their eyes peeled,” Cayler says.

Chief Cayler asks that residents lock their doors. “I don’t know that the subject is going to be dangerous at this point, but we want to close all of his avenues of escape,” Cayler says. He says the man is a black male, approximately five-seven 150 pounds, 27 years old. Cayler asks anyone who sees the man to call 9-1-1 immediately. The stabbing was reported at 7:20 this morning.
